THE JUNIOR LEAGUE OF BUFFALO ANNOUNCES 2023 HIGH SCHOOL SCHOLARSHIP WINNERS

The Junior League of Buffalo is pleased to announce that the following students have each been awarded a $2,000 scholarship:

 

  • Tiffany Nguyen of Cheektowaga Central High School
  • Aisha Makama of Niagara Falls High School
  • Macey Blum of Hamburg High School

 

Each student is a graduating female high school senior who has demonstrated a strong commitment to community service and volunteerism in the Western New York Community. The scholarships are given to the post-high school institution to assist the student in defraying expenses for tuition, books, fees, or housing. The scholarships are awarded based on evidence of demonstrated community service and volunteerism within their school and community. Additionally, the students’ backgrounds show strong evidence of being well-rounded in personal and academic endeavors.

 

“We are thrilled to award these very deserving students with a scholarship that we hope will make a difference in their post-high school endeavors,” said Stephanie Wilkinson, Junior League of Buffalo Scholarship Committee Chair. “Each year we are happy to continue to be able to offer young women an opportunity to be rewarded for their commitment to their community.”

 

 

About the Junior League of Buffalo:

The Junior League of Buffalo is an organization of women committed to voluntarism, developing the potential of women and improving communities through the effective action and leadership of trained volunteers. Its purpose is exclusively educational and charitable.
